The problem I face is that when doing heists, the cars just have a (2), (3) or (4) after and I never really know which I'm taking, suppose it doesn't matter but still, is there a way to perhaps legitimately alter the names so I can tell? REXX Posted January 15, 2016 Share Posted January 15, 2016 You can't alter the names. However, the one closest to your garage door on the right (10 car garage, looking towards the TV) will be the higher number. The farther away, the lower the number. darkgreenmeme Posted January 15, 2016 Share Posted January 15, 2016 No on renaming. I'm not 100% on this, but the cars should be ordered by property, then the internal list in the property. You can see these lists when you call the mechanic. If you keep them in the same garage, you can arrange them from the blue marker in that garage. The internal list order should be displayed while you do this. If you set the order, you know which is which. Nadki 1 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

We Are Ninja Posted January 15, 2016 Share Posted January 15, 2016 (edited) There's no way to name them. You just have to remember which car is in which slot in your garage. IIRC, the order is [back of garage] 10 5 9 4 8 3 7 2 6 1 [Front of garage (where doors are)] So, in the pic above, the five Massacros would be listed as: Massacro (Racecar) 5 Massacro (Racecar) 4 Massacro (Racecar) 3 Massacro (Racecar) 2 Massacro (Racecar) 1 If you wanted the red Massacro in back, you'd pic Massacro (Racecar) 5 If you wanted the yellow one in front, you'd pick Massacro (Racecar) 1 If you wanted the white one in the middle, you'd pick Massacro (Racecar) 3 I keep mine grouped together because of OCD, but it makes it easy to find them during heist setups and when calling the mechanic. If they're not together, picking the right one via mechanic should be easy enough, but the heist setup screen is a little different. Hope that helps... In my experience, though, with Heists it's a bit different. It usually spawns whichever version of the car it wants regardless of which number you choose. -.- Edited January 15, 2016 by We Are Ninja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
